In a press conference on Wednesday, National Football League Commissioner Roger Goodell said that he understands the frustration of Saints fans over a missed call in the NFC championship game.
Goodell called referees men and women of high integrity but said “the game is not officiated by robots.”
Goodell suggested that the NFL was willing to look into instant replay technology as part of officiating.
When asked about if he had considered calling for a rematch, Goodell read directly from NFL rules explaining that it was not within his authority.
The NFL fined Los Angeles Rams Nickell Robey-Coleman earlier this week for the helmet-to-helmet hit in the NFC championship game that Goodell says should have been called during the game.
